Manish Sisodia gets additional charge of Health Ministry after Satyendar Jain tested positive for Covid-19

Delhi Deputy Chief Minister ‘Manish Sisodia‘ has been given the additional charge of the health department as the Health Minister of Delhi
Satyendar Jain‘ tested positive for the novel coronavirus on Wednesday and being treated in hospital.

Manish Sisodia will take charge of the departments that are handled by Health Minister Satyendar Jain as well along with his own responsibilities.

Delhi Health Minister Satyendar Jain had tested positive for Covid-19 on Wednesday, each day after he was admitted to a hospital with a high fever and suffering a sudden drop in oxygen level in the body.

After the minister tested positive on Wednesday, Delhi government began searching and enquiring the people who interacted with him in the last a couple of days and contact them for knowing whether they have any symptoms of covid-19.

Warning them to be conscious about health and safety.

On Sunday, the 55-year-old minister had attended a high-level meeting on coronavirus situation in the national capital, chaired by Union Home Minister Amit Shah, in which Delhi Lt Governor Anil Baijal, Kejriwal, his deputy Manish Sisodia and Union Health Minister Harsh Vardhan also attended to this meeting.

Jain was brought to the Rajiv Gandhi Super Speciality Hospital (RGSSH) on Tuesday morning and was administered a test for novel coronavirus infection that morning, for which he tested negative.

In a tweet on Tuesday morning, soon after the news broke out of Satyendar Jain has been admitted to a Delhi hospital, Kejriwal said, “You have been working for the people day and night, without a care for your own health. Please take care of your well-being and get well soon.”

But with the media, the officials said that “He was still running a fever and showing symptoms, so we had decided to run another test on Wednesday, after 24 hours of the primary test,” a senior official said.

He tested positive on Wednesday and is kept on a ventilator as it would be a good treatment for covid-19 the official said.

Doctors at the RGSSH said his condition is “stable” but he has been put on oxygen support as it would be safe to do so.
